About

Café Vasco Da Gama centers its culinary focus on the vibrant traditions of Portuguese street food culture. The menu features an extensive selection of pressed sandwiches crafted with premium ingredients and authentic crusty breads. Signature offerings highlight marinated meats and savory fillings that define classic Mediterranean snacking profiles. Patrons encounter a bustling atmosphere designed for quick service and consistent quality in every preparation. Freshly brewed coffee complements the robust flavors found within the diverse sandwich catalog. The establishment maintains a professional standard by prioritizing speed, traditional flavor combinations, and high-quality sourced components. This venue serves as a reliable destination for those seeking a direct and efficient experience rooted in the heart of Portuguese culinary heritage.

Review Summary

Café Vasco Da Gama is widely regarded as a charming, European-inspired destination in Montreal that offers a cozy atmosphere and a welcoming escape from the city. Many patrons praise the establishment for its high-quality coffee, fresh pastries, and flavorful sandwiches, with several visitors highlighting the authentic Portuguese influence. While the majority of guests appreciate the friendly service and consistent food quality, some find the pricing to be high and occasionally report inconsistencies in service speed. Overall, the establishment is frequently recommended for breakfast or a casual social outing, successfully capturing a warm, inviting environment that encourages repeat visits.
